intert too many links

Jan 24, 2011 at 1:04 AM

I want to do this.

I add to many links. for example

and I want to this with only one clicks



How can I do that ?

Mar 3, 2011 at 11:19 AM
Edited Mar 3, 2011 at 11:22 AM

Do it in the php-parser ;) it's easier I think (at least for me :P)


//search for example [url=,de/]Google[/url]
$newtext = preg_replace("/\[url=(.*?)\](.*?)\[\/url\]/", "<a href=\"\\1\" target='_blank'>\\2</a>", $oldtext);
//search for [url]link[/url] or [URL]link[/URL] and replaced it t a normal link without any tags or BBcodes
$newtext = preg_replace("/\[url\]www.(.*)\[\/url\]/isU", "http://www.$1", $oldtext);
//this function you are looking for -> search for a normal Link and replaced it
$newtext = preg_replace('#(^|[^"=]{1})(http://|ftp://|mailto:|news:)([^\s<>]+)([\s\n<>]|$)#sm','\1<a href="\2\3">\2\3</a>\4',$oldtext);

You see actually you don't need this function in your WYSIWYG-Editor ;)